## Build Agent Clock Skew

Our Fernwood build agents occasionally drift by several seconds, which breaks signed artifact timestamps in the Larkspur pipeline. Always verify NTP sync against the Meridian time service before debugging failed builds. To query the Meridian skew-report endpoint directly, authenticate with the key below.

gateway credential: kto23_LX9A4ys6i4nzHtpOLNLodKK

**Session refresh bug — quick recap for the sync.** Turns out Lanternfox was refreshing tokens on every request instead of near-expiry, so the auth tier got hammered whenever Quillport's mobile client woke from background. Dara patched the refresh predicate to check remaining TTL with jitter, which cut refresh calls by roughly 90% in staging. We still need agreement on the windows before rollout, since they interact with the gateway cache. Here are the constants we're proposing for Thursday's canary.

limits module of fajog-tawig:
RATE_LIMITS = {
    "druwyn": 2,
    "quenael": 10,
    "wenix": 2,
    "druael": 2,
}

Welcome, new folks — please read carefully. The Nimbusforge secrets vault holding warm-pool configuration for our serverless handlers locked itself after the quarterly seal check. Without those configs, the Driftway functions fall back to full cold starts, and p95 latency roughly triples, which customers on the Oakmere plan will notice quickly. Unlocking requires the standard recovery flow: open the vault console, select manual recovery, and enter the passphrase given below.

strongbox words: norwyn-wenael-aldvan-aldiel-wendor-holael